I tested both the 350Z & the G35 before deciding to go for the Boxster.

They are NOT just 'rice rockets' that mimic real sports cars like Porsches.

The 350Z is an outstanding car which handles extremely well, is powerful & quick and is a real alternative to the Boxster/Z4/TT group of sports cars.

They have great build integrity & no IMS or RMS problems.

The G35 is pretty much a 350Z with back seats.
